Description | The protein encoded by this gene is a multifunctional, nuclear phosphoprotein that plays a role in cell cycle progression, apoptosis and cellular transformation. It functions as a transcription factor that regulates transcription of specific target genes. Mutations, overexpression, rearrangement and translocation of this gene have been associated with a variety of hematopoietic tumors, leukemias and lymphomas, including Burkitt lymphoma. There is evidence to show that alternative translation initiations from an upstream, in-frame non-AUG (CUG) and a downstream AUG start site result in the production of two isoforms with distinct N-termini. The synthesis of non-AUG initiated protein is suppressed in Burkitt's lymphomas, suggesting its importance in the normal function of this gene. [provided by RefSeq, Jul 2008] |
Immunogen | A synthetic peptide corresponding to residues 410-419 (EQKLISEEDL) coupled to KLH. |
Isotype | IgG1 |
Concentration | 100ug/100ul |
Recommended Dilutions | Western Blot (1:1000), Immunoprecipitation and Immunostaining (1:200). Other dilutions will need optimization by end user. |
Storage Buffer | PBS, pH 7.4 with 0.05% sodium azide. |
Storage Condition | This product is stable for several weeks at 4° C as an undiluted liquid. Dilute only prior to immediate use. For extended storage, aliquot contents and freeze at -20° C or below. Avoid cycles of freezing and thawing. Expiration date is one (1) year from date of receipt. |
Formulation | Liquid |
Specificity | Myc-tag Monoclonal Antibody. Recognises over-expressed proteins containing Myc epitope tag fused to either amino- or carboxy-termini of targeted proteins in transfected mammalian cells. |

What is the positive control for this antibody? | |
Cat#L001 - Myc Tag Cell Lysate is a great positive control for this antibody. This control contains 293 cell lysate that were transfected with a Myc-tagged minigene, sized 37 kDa.
